Everyone in the program knows I use Linux on my Computers for numerous reasons but for the short version because it works. I have to use Libre office because Microsoft Office just isn't a viable solution for me. I know it can run using crossover but that's not a program I want to buy when I can just use Libre. For the most part documents and power points open perfectly fine with no issue. The issues come up when I'm sent documents that either have crazy formatting applied or some kind of embedded data in the document. I've ask thats everyone just save everything in doc or ppt etc... format and that no one uses crazy formatting. For the most part maybe 90%+ of the time there is no issue, it's the 10% that bothers me, all you have to do is to select the doc format when you save or the ppt format and there will be no issue.
I'm a Libre Office fan, it's one of the only good office solutions on the market as it's free and cross platform, something Microsoft Office can't say for itself;. My only lasting big peeve is that Libre can't seem to open a docx document with out having formatting / rendering issues. It also can't copy charts from a doc / docx and keep the chart in tact. Other then that's it's a bullet proof office suite, does any one have this issue or have a fix for this issue?

iPad2 Stats Taken from Apple!
1GHz dual-core A5 CPU
512MB RAM
16GB, 32GB, 64GB storage options
Front & Rear Cameras, front is VGA, rear is 720p
9.7 LED display with 1024×768 screen resolution at 132ppi
GPU said to be 9x faster
Video output supports up to 1080p
Runs iOS 4.3
10 hour battery life
White & Black color options
3G models are AT&T and Verizon compatible
1.3 lbs
Thinner build
